Based on February 2026 Police data, Huddersfield recorded fewer crimes than Queensbury — 153 vs 224 incidents. That is 32% fewer crimes. Queensbury is above the national average.
The main difference lies in crime type. In February 2026, Huddersfield saw higher rates of Public order and Other theft while Queensbury had more Burglary and Criminal damage & arson. Overall, Huddersfield recorded fewer total crimes (153 vs 224).
